MySQLにテーブルをインポートする方法のアイディアは何ですか?
MySQLのコマンドラインツールまたはグラフィカルツールを使用して、1つのテーブルから別のテーブルにデータをインポートする方法は以下の通りです:
- 既存のテーブルにデータを挿入するためにINSERT INTO SELECTステートメントを使用します。まず、CREATE TABLEステートメントを使用して目標のテーブルを作成し、次にINSERT INTO SELECTステートメントを使用してソーステーブルからデータを選択して目標テーブルに挿入します。
CREATE TABLE new_table LIKE old_table;
INSERT INTO new_table SELECT * FROM old_table;
- LOAD DATA INFILE文を使用する: この方法は、ファイルからデータを表にインポートするために適しています。まず、データをテキストファイルに保存し、次にLOAD DATA INFILE文を使用してデータをファイルから読み取り、表にインポートします。
LOAD DATA INFILE 'path/to/file' INTO TABLE table_name;
- MySQLのインポートツールを使用する:MySQLにはmysqlimportやMySQL Workbenchといったツールが用意されており、ファイルからデータを表に簡単にインポートすることができます。これらのツールはコマンドラインまたはグラフィカルインターフェースを通して使用することができます。
– どの方法を使っても、データの構造が一致していることを確認して、データのインポートエラーを防ぐ必要があります。